It's a bit better but still far from clear. The upper brown wire, that's clamped onto the orange/white/silver flecked wire. That looks like it's going into the middle of the second row of B135 (the middle plug)...? If so it's likely to be going to pin 14, which is the engine speed output waveform that drives the revcounter, and as such the box at the other end of those wires was probably a shiftlight or similar.
